Rose petals are beneficial to both skin and overall wellness. It is not only applied topically but also swallowed, making it edible! Gulkand is a delicious example of rose petals in the diet. One of the key reasons roses are beneficial for skin is because they:

• Seal moisture in the skin

• Cool the skin and body

• Act as a natural sunscreen to defend against UV radiation damage

• Soothe sensitive skin

1. Homemade Rose Water:

Rose Petals Benefits

Although most of us use store-bought rose water, it does contain preservatives to keep its smell and freshness. To avoid preservatives, it is preferable to prepare them at home. So follow the following steps to get fresh homemade rose water:

• Take fresh rose petals, Remove dirt and debris from rose petals by washing them.

• Combine rose petals and water in a pan in a 1:2 ratio. Set the flame to low.

• When the water level drops and the roses turn pale, switch off the gas.

• Set it aside to allow the water to cool.

• Transfer to a spray bottle and use it on a daily basis.

• This water can also be frozen in an ice tray and used as facial massage cubes.

 2. Homemade Cleanser

Benefits of Rose Petals

Have you ever tried a face cleanser with rose extract? If not, we'll show you how to make one at home. This facial cleanser, on the other hand, will not aid a dirty or filthy face. This is best used at night to cleanse the skin and let it rejuvenate throughout the night.

• Place one cup of fresh rose petals in a basin and soak them for 4-5 hours in water.

• Mash the petals in the same water as they get soft.

• Make a cleanser with two teaspoons of honey.

• Keep it in a bottle and use it whenever you want.

 4. Rose Petal Hydrating Mask

Benefits of Rose Petals

This is a simple face mask that requires a few materials readily available in your kitchen. You'll need mashed rose petals, chickpea flour, yogurt, and water or rosewater to make this mask. This mask hydrates dry and parched skin well.

  • Mix all ingredients in a bowl.
  • Apply to the entire face and leave on for 10 minutes.
  • To lock in the moisture, wash the mask and apply an excellent moisturizing moisturizer.

5. Face Pack with Sandalwood and Rose Petals

Benefits of Rose Petals

This face mask is the finest thing you can do for your skin to cool it down if it gets burned easily in hot and humid summer weather.

• Mash clean and fresh rose petals.

• Combine mashed petals, sandalwood powder, and water in a basin.

• Prepare a smooth paste and apply it to your entire face and neck.

• After becoming sunburned, you can also put this on your hands.

• Wait until it has dried before washing it off.

• You can also scrub it and remove it to get rid of dead skin cells.
